Globefish Definition
glōbfĭsh
globefishes
noun
Any puffer fish or porcupinefish.
Webster's New World
Any of various fishes, especially an ocean sunfish or a pufferfish, having or capable of assuming a globular shape.
American Heritage
Synonyms:
Other Word Forms of Globefish
Noun
Singular:
globefish
Plural:
globefishesFind Similar Words
Find similar words to globefish using the buttons below.